Q: How to Replace a Power Steering Hose for Pressure Hose on Chevrolet Blazer?
A: The process of replacing the power steering pressure hose begins with lifting the vehicle to a proper height then supporting it safely before removing any existing steering linkage shields. Place a drain pan below as the next step. Start by detaching the power steering pressure hose from the pump then lower the vehicle while also taking off the air cleaner assembly. The power steering gear pressure hose needs attachment removal from the power steering gear and vehicle removal of the hose before the process continues. The power steering gear pressure hose must be connected to the power steering gear on the vehicle before tightening it to 30 nm (22 ft. Lbs.). Locate the power steering pressure hose on the pump then tightly fasten it to 25 nm (18 ft. Lbs.) while keeping the vehicle raised. After removing the drain pan the steering linkage shield should be installed if equipped then the vehicle should be lowered before finishing with power steering system bleeding.
